site stats

Delete records in sql table where condition

WebSQL - Delete Table. The SQL DELETE TABLE command is used to delete the existing records from a table in a database. If we wish to delete only the specific number of rows from the table, we can use the WHERE clause with the DELETE query. If we omit the WHERE clause, all rows in the table will be deleted. The SQL DELETE query operates … WebTo remove one or more rows from a table, you use the DELETE statement. The general syntax for the DELETE statement is as follows: First, provide the name of the table where you want to remove rows. Second, specify the condition in the WHERE clause to identify the rows that need to be deleted. If you omit the WHERE clause all rows in the table ...

SQL DELETE Statement - W3Schools

WebApr 10, 2024 · The DELETE statement allows you to remove rows from a table based on specified conditions. The basic syntax for the DELETE statement consists of the DELETE FROM keyword, followed by the table name, and an optional WHERE clause to filter the rows to be deleted. Example: DELETE FROM employees WHERE department_id = 5; WebDelete from two tables in one query. #messages table : messageid messagetitle . . #usersmessages table usersmessageid messageid userid . . Now if I want to delete from messages table it's ok. But when I delete message by messageid the record still exists on usersmessage and I have to delete from this two tables at once. nawran dropshipping course download https://stork-net.com

SQL Server - fast way to delete records based on a table join condition …

WebFeb 12, 2024 · Here are two approaches to delete records from a table using SQL: (1) Delete records based on specified conditions: DELETE FROM table_name WHERE condition (2) Delete all the records in a given table: DELETE FROM table_name In the next section, you’ll see how to apply the above approaches using a practical example. ... WebJun 27, 2012 · As I assume the best way to delete huge amount of records is to delete it by Primary Key. (What is Primary Key see here) So you have to generate tsql script that contains the whole list of lines to delete and after this execute this script. For example code below is gonna generate that file WebOct 19, 2009 · Jan 12, 2016 at 10:22. Add a comment. 1. To Delete table records based on another table. Delete From Table1 a,Table2 b where a.id=b.id Or DELETE FROM Table1 WHERE Table1.id IN (SELECT Table2.id FROM Table2) Or DELETE Table1 FROM Table1 t1 INNER JOIN Table2 t2 ON t1.ID = t2.ID; Share. naw phaw eh htar photo

SQL DELETE Statement - W3Schools

Category:Using UPDATE and DELETE Statements — SQLAlchemy 2.0 …

Tags:Delete records in sql table where condition

Delete records in sql table where condition

mysql - Delete from one table with join - Stack Overflow

WebThe first is simply to change the DELETE condition. WHEN NOT MATCHED BY SOURCE AND target.AccountId IN (SELECT AccountId FROM @Items) THEN DELETE; The second is to use a CTE to restrict the target. WITH cte as ( SELECT ItemId, AccountId FROM @myTable m WHERE EXISTS (SELECT * FROM @Items i WHERE i.AccountId = …

Delete records in sql table where condition

Did you know?

WebMar 7, 2024 · RemoveIf function. Use the RemoveIf function to remove a record or records based on a condition or a set of conditions. Each condition can be any formula that results in a true or false and can reference columns of the data source by name. Each condition is evaluated individually for each record, and the record is removed if all … WebDELETE Syntax. DELETE FROM table_name WHERE condition; Note: Be careful when deleting records in a table! Notice the WHERE clause in the DELETE statement. The WHERE clause specifies which record (s) should be deleted. If you omit the WHERE … SQL Inner Join Keyword - SQL DELETE Statement - W3Schools The table above contains five records (one for each customer) and seven columns … SQL Delete . Exercise 1 Exercise 2 Go to SQL Delete Tutorial. SQL Functions . … W3Schools offers free online tutorials, references and exercises in all the major … The SQL SELECT DISTINCT Statement. The SELECT DISTINCT statement is … SQL HAVING Clause - SQL DELETE Statement - W3Schools SQL LEFT JOIN Keyword. The LEFT JOIN keyword returns all records from the left … The SQL CASE Expression. The CASE expression goes through conditions and … The SQL UNION Operator. The UNION operator is used to combine the result … The SQL GROUP BY Statement. The GROUP BY statement groups rows that …

WebOct 19, 2024 · 1. Normally I would truncate the data like this: truncate table DST.BreaksDST. However, I need to only delete data in which a join to another table contains a source of 'DST'. My SELECT statement looks like this: select dstid, dst.breakid from DST.BreaksDST dst join base.breaks b on dst.BreakId = b.BreakId where b.source … WebMar 23, 2024 · 11 - Bolide. 03-24-2024 11:17 AM. Output Data tool has a "Pre Create SQL Statement" configuration option that allows you to execute SQL statement before committing records to database. To make the SQL statement dynamic, you'll have to put the Output Data tool in a macro and use an Action to update the " Pre Create SQL Statement" at …

WebHome - Concatly WebTo delete the whole records from the table, we do not need to use any other condition while executing the delete query; we need to use only the table name with the delete …

WebApr 5, 2024 · The update() SQL Expression Construct¶. The update() function generates a new instance of Update which represents an UPDATE statement in SQL, that will update existing data in a table.. Like the insert() construct, there is a “traditional” form of update(), which emits UPDATE against a single table at a time and does not return any …

WebJan 13, 2013 · Edit: To store data from both table without duplicates, do this. INSERT INTO TABLE1 SELECT * FROM TABLE2 A WHERE NOT EXISTS (SELECT 1 FROM TABLE1 X WHERE A.NAME = X.NAME AND A.post_code = x.post_code) This will insert rows from table2 that do not match name, postal code from table1. Alternative is that You can also … marks warehouse olds abWebTo delete an entire record/row from a table, enter delete from followed by the table name, followed by the where clause which contains the conditions to delete. If you leave off … nawraoffer.comWebAug 21, 2024 · A SQL delete statement without any conditions. In data manipulation language (DML) statements, a SQL delete statement removes the rows from a table. You can delete a specific row or all rows. ... (CTE) to delete the rows from a SQL table as well. First, we define a CTE to find the row that we want to remove. Then, we join the CTE … nawran footballWebDec 26, 2014 · I want to delete some rows contain specific data at specific row. Ex: the table name is EXAM I want to delete row 1 and row 3 when input condition string is C. I … nawpic wallpapersWebJul 9, 2013 · Your second DELETE query was nearly correct. Just be sure to put the table name (or an alias) between DELETE and FROM to specify which table you are deleting from. This is simpler than using a nested SELECT statement like in the other answers.. Corrected Query (option 1: using full table name): DELETE tableA FROM tableA INNER … nawras express logistics limitedWebApr 10, 2024 · The DELETE statement allows you to remove rows from a table based on specified conditions. The basic syntax for the DELETE statement consists of the … nawra scotlandWebSep 23, 2024 · How to Delete multiple rows from a table in SQL. One way we can delete multiple rows from our cats table is to change the condition from id to gender. If we wanted to delete the rows with just the male cats, then we can use the gender="M" condition. DELETE FROM cats WHERE gender="M"; Our new cats table would look like this: marks warehouse overalls